Common Questions

How much does solar cost in Franklin?

Solar in Franklin, Tennessee costs approximately $22,837 for a 8 kW system. After the 30% federal tax credit, your net cost is about $15,986.

What is the solar payback period in Franklin?

The estimated payback period for solar in Franklin is 10.9 years, based on a $150/month electric bill and local sun hours of 4.8 hrs/day.
